USB 3.0 flexible interface |
The SuperSpeed USB 3.0 interface enables freestanding operation so that the ADQ7 can be physically located close to the detector rather than inside the host PC. The cable between the detector and the digitizer can thereby be kept very short for optimal signal quality. The USB type B connector is equipped with screw posts for securing the USB cable. Cables compliant with the AIA USB3 Vision standard can be used. With the USB3.0 interface, the digitizer is easily interfaced to any PC. The combination of a sustained data rate of up to 200 MBytes/ s, on-board signal processing and the ease-of-use of the USB 3.0 interface enables a flexible and efficient system solution. |
